WILDLIFE SUPERHIGHWAY
THE LAND: 18.4 million acres spread across Wyoming, Montana, Idaho, Oregon,
and Washington.

NO CURRENT ENVIRONMENTAL PROPOSAL matches the Northern Rockies Ecosystem
Protection Act for size, sweep, and sheer brassy political nerve.  The bill
would create a patchwork of protected lands throughout the Northern Rockies
and all the way to Canada. The proposal is not a luxury, argues Mike Bader,
executive director of the Alliance for the Wild Rockies.  Without it,
"We'll lose the grizzly."

WHO'S FOR: Fifty-two members of Congress, backed by the Sierra Club, the
Audubon Society, and a grassroots group called Republicans for
Environmental Protection.

WHO'S AGAINST: Most of the region's congressional delegations, along with
GOP heavyweight (and former Idaho senator) Steve Symms, who judiciously
described passage of the bill as "the end of Western Civilization as we
know it."

THE ODDS: Lots of political toes are getting squashed. The longest of
longshots.
